Abstract

The rice plant cultivation and strengthening agent and using method thereof relate to plant cultivation and strengthening agent and using method thereof, which solves the problems of less nutrition content, larger dosage, high production and transport cost, high labor intensity and complexity in fertilization, labor and time consumption in prior rice plant cultivation and strengthening agent. Therice plant cultivation and strengthening agent comprises nutrition elements, flavohumic acid, acid regulating agent, sequestering agent, water conservation agent, disinfectant, plant growth regulator,phlogiston, mould inhibitor, and additive. The using method is that: 1. the rice plant cultivation and strengthening agent is added with water in a proportion of 1 to 1000 times; 2. the solution is applied in the land with a proportion of 500g of the agent to 50m2 of the land; 3. the rice is planted when the agent is fully permeated in the soil. The rice plant cultivation and strengthening agentof the invention has high content of nutrition and the dosage of 10g in 1m2 land, thereby reducing production and transport cost and labor intensity in fertilization. The using of the rice plant cultivation and strengthening agent combines the fertilization, pH regulation, disinfection and first watering together, which is of time and labor saving.

Background technology
Rice in north china need carry out the seedling of canopy film in the cold time in early spring, sprout at seed rice, emerge, rice shoot is endangered by microthermal climate usually in the process of growth, and easily damping-off takes place, bacterial wilt and yellow seedling diseases.Use fertilizer for improving the growth of seedlings can alleviate the influence of weather and disease to rice shoot.
At present the fertilizer for improving the growth of seedlings that uses mainly is made up of the acidulants of the absorption vitriol oils such as flyash, brown coal, rice husk and rice seedling nutritive element, sterilization and disinfection agricultural chemicals; Wherein the acidulants consumption is big, accounts for more than 65%, and nutritive element content is then less relatively, and seed germination rate and seedling rate are not had obvious promoter action.The unit surface consumption of fertilizer for improving the growth of seedlings is big at present, is about 150~600g/m 2, production cost height not only, and increased the labour intensity of transportation cost and fertilising.
Need when present fertilizer for improving the growth of seedlings uses earlier with mix with 5~6 times of fine earths again behind these several composition mixings through screening mix even, be made into nutrition soil, again nutrition soil evenly be sprinkling upon on the smooth good seedbed face, flatten, water end water, after oozing, water just can sow, and time-consuming.

Embodiment
Embodiment one: the present embodiment rice nursery sock growing seedling strengthen agent is made up of 50%~80% nutrient substance, 0.5%~5% xanthohumic acid, 5%~20% acidity regulator, 1%~5% sequestrant, 10%~40% water-holding agent, 1%~5% disinfection sanitizer, 0.2%~2.0% plant-growth regulator, 0.01%~0.5% phlogiston, 0.1%~1.0% mould inhibitor and the additive of surplus by weight percentage.
Embodiment two: the difference of present embodiment and embodiment one is: rice nursery sock growing seedling strengthen agent is made up of 52%~70% nutrient substance, 1%~4% xanthohumic acid, 7%~18% acidity regulator, 1.5%~4.5% sequestrant, 12%~30% water-holding agent, 1.5%~4.5% disinfection sanitizer, 0.5%~1.8% plant-growth regulator, 0.1%~0.4% phlogiston, 0.2%~0.9% mould inhibitor and the additive of surplus by weight percentage.Other is identical with embodiment one.
Embodiment three: the difference of present embodiment and embodiment one is: rice nursery sock growing seedling strengthen agent is made up of 60% nutrient substance, 2% xanthohumic acid, 10% acidity regulator, 3% sequestrant, 20% water-holding agent, 3% disinfection sanitizer, 1% plant-growth regulator, 0.3% phlogiston, 0.5% mould inhibitor and 0.2% additive by weight percentage.Other is identical with embodiment one.
The contrast experiment:
1, test in strong sprout
The Tianmen township carries out the rice nursery sock growing seedling strengthen simultaneous test in the Fangzheng County, Heilongjiang Province.The test site is divided into two seedbeds (seedbed 1 and seedbed 2), and each seedbed is established treatment group (applying the strong order agent of seedling cultivation of rice) and control group (applying present north rice seedling-growth soil regulator commonly used) respectively.Sowing on April 15th, 2004, other sowing condition is all identical except that the fertilizer for improving the growth of seedlings that applies, temperature is lower 2~3 ℃ than former years, carrying out the field on May 18 detects, on each seedbed, respectively divide three zones that area is identical, each regional random sampling 10 strain rice seedling claims bright the kind with clear water flush away root earth, the back of drying in the shade.The experimental data in two seedbeds is respectively as table 1 and table 2.
Table 1
Seedbed 1 The I district The II district The III district X±S Rate of increase (%)
Control group 2.1 2.0 2.2 2.1±0.08 -
Treatment group 2.7 2.6 2.6 2.6±0.05 25.2(P<0.01)
Table 2
Seedbed 2 The I district The II district The III district X±S Rate of increase (%)
Control group 2.2 1.8 1.8 1.93± 1.89 -
Treatment group 3.1 2.7 3.0 2.93± 0.17 51.8(P<0.01)
The detected result of the paddy rice seedling fresh weight from table 1, table 2 as can be seen, the paddy rice seedling fresh weight of treatment group that uses the present embodiment rice nursery sock growing seedling strengthen agent is apparently higher than control group.The paddy rice seedling fresh weight of treatment group is than control group high by 25.2% (P<0.01) in the table 1, the paddy rice seedling fresh weight of treatment group is than control group high by 51.8% (P<0.01) in the table 2, illustrate that the present embodiment rice nursery sock growing seedling strengthen agent can promote the growth of paddy rice shoot root system and rice shoot, has the effect of strong seedling.
2, anti-damping-off
The seedbed, test site that will be under the physical environment is divided into two groups of treatment group (applying rice nursery sock growing seedling strengthen agent) and control group (applying present north rice seedling-growth soil regulator commonly used).Random sampling 100 strains respectively of 3 zones of every component, damping-off morbidity statistic data is as shown in table 3.
Table 3
The I district The II district The III district On average (%)
Control group 7 6 6 6.3
Treatment group 0 0 0 0
Statistics shows that the present embodiment rice nursery sock growing seedling strengthen agent has good anti-damping-off effect.

Embodiment five: present embodiment and embodiment one, two, three or fours' difference is: nutrient substance is made up of 3 parts of urea, 12 parts of Secondary ammonium phosphates, 1.8 parts of ammonium sulfate, 15 parts of potassium primary phosphates, 15 parts of Sodium phosphate dibasics, 3 parts of saltpetre, 3 parts of siliceous fertilizers, 1.2 parts of ferrous sulfate, 0.5 part of zinc sulfate, 0.8 part of boric acid, 0.4 part of sal epsom and 0.5 part of calcium chloride by ratio of weight and the number of copies.Other is identical with embodiment one, two, three or four.
Nutrition in the present embodiment all is the necessary nutritive ingredient of crop; Silicon is the important nutritive element of plant materials, executes the photosynthesis that siliceous fertilizer helps improving crop, and crop forms silicified cell after absorbing silicon in vivo, make the thickening of cauline leaf cells of superficial layer wall, stratum corneum increases, and improves the intensity of cell walls, and strain shape is tall and straight, cauline leaf is upright, improves photosynthetic efficiency, and is resistant to lodging; Ferro element can prevent yellow seedling diseases; The molecular weight of xanthohumic acid is little, and is soluble in water, easily by plant absorbing, can alleviate the harm of low temperature to weaning stage (1 heart stage of 3 leaves) rice seedling behind the plant absorbing xanthohumic acid, the rice shoot root of hair early, well developed root system, rice shoot stalwartness, seedling rot phenomenon obviously reduce.
Embodiment six: present embodiment and embodiment one, two, three or fours' difference is: acidity regulator is one or more the mixture in citric acid, tartrate, oxalic acid, the oxysuccinic acid.Other is identical with embodiment one, two, three or four.
Acidity regulator in the present embodiment can concern for arbitrary proportion between each component if be made up of two or more material.
Present embodiment adopts organic acid to replace the vitriol oil, is of value to environment, and acid soil can destroy the life condition of pathogenic bacteria, and then suppresses growth of pathogenic bacteria.
Embodiment seven: present embodiment and embodiment one, two, three or fours' difference is: sequestrant is one or more the mixture in ethylenediamine tetraacetic acid (EDTA) (EDTA), hydroxyethyl second two ammonium nitrilotriacetics (HEDTA), quadrol two ortho position phenol acetate (EDDHA), the diethylene triamine pentacetic acid (DTPA) (DTPA).Other is identical with embodiment one, two, three or four.
Sequestrant in the present embodiment can concern for arbitrary proportion between each component if be made up of two or more material.
The micro-metals agent chelating that is chelated can improve plant to trace element utilizing rate.
Embodiment eight: present embodiment and embodiment one, two, three or fours' difference is: water-holding agent is one or more the mixture in sodium polyacrylate, polyacrylamide, the starch grafted acrylate.Other is identical with embodiment one, two, three or four.
Water-holding agent in the present embodiment can concern for arbitrary proportion between each component if be made up of two or more material.
Water-holding agent has suction, water conservation and releases the water effect, can keep moisture not run off, and reduces the nursery stage number of times that waters, help that the crop seedling is complete, seedling is neat, seedling is strong, promoted growing of crop, strengthened drought resisting, the cold tolerance of crop, accelerated to nourish and grow and the reproductive growth process; Dip in the root transplanting but also can be used for early rice, early rice is turned green ahead of time, improve surviving rate, increase effective fringe and output.
